What is "cross checking" when reading?

Explanation:
Cross checking in the context of reading refers to the strategy of bringing together different sources of information to verify understanding and accuracy while reading. This process allows readers to evaluate whether the information they are processing makes sense based on the context of the text, illustrations, previous knowledge, or other cues. For instance, when a reader encounters a piece of text and is unsure about a word or concept, they might use pictures or captions within the text, their prior knowledge about the topic, or related elements in the surrounding text to confirm their understanding. This multi-faceted approach helps students develop more robust comprehension skills, as they learn to draw on various resources rather than relying on a single source of information. Engaging in cross checking encourages readers to be more active and reflective in their reading process, ultimately leading to a deeper understanding of the material.

What Is Cross-Checking Anyway?

Cross-checking in reading is all about keeping things in check. It’s not about spelling complex words or sticking to illustrations like a toddler. Instead, it's a strategic method where you pull together different sources of information to confirm your understanding. Think of it like being a detective, piecing together clues from various sources to get the full picture.

When you come across something that doesn’t quite register, you tap into your treasure chest of knowledge—images, other texts, and maybe even your previous experiences on the topic. By blending these layers together, you create a more vivid and accurate comprehension.

How to Cross-Check Like a Pro

Now, let’s break down some practical steps to finesse your cross-checking skills. Think of it as building your reading arsenal.

1. Visual Cues

As you read, don’t just gloss over illustrations or captions. Use them! They’re vital pieces of the puzzle that can shed light on what you’re reading. A well-placed diagram can make complex concepts feel like a casual stroll through a park.

2. Connect the Dots

Remember your previous knowledge. It’s like a bridge connecting you to new information. Did you read something related in another book? Use that context to pull together what you know with what you're reading.

3. Seek Out Multiple Sources

This is where the magic happens. If you can, gather different materials related to the subject at hand. Online articles, videos, and textbooks are all fair game. This approach allows you to compare perspectives and build a more rounded understanding.

4. Ask Questions

What does this mean? Why is it important? Asking yourself questions can encourage critical thinking and reflection, pulling you even deeper into comprehension.
